Her feet barely touched the ground, light on her bare toes as she walked through her house completing her standard morning routine. It truly was her favorite time of day, being a morning person rather than a night owl, for numerous reasons.

Seren could see her front yard in the morning, watching the newly sprouted flowers on bushes waft in direction of the breeze from the kitchen table, the white fuzz on dandelions joining the winds, detaching from their buds.

Most people loathed dandelions, they were pestering weeds and the bane of the existence of most lawns.

Seren couldn't help but love them.

Ever since she was little, she would pull them out from their roots and blow on them to watch the white fluff scatter with the winds, flying away freely.

She would make a wish before blowing, in hopes that her wishes would come true.

Her lovely garden and warm tea weren't the only reason for her singing heart that morning, it was also because of Hoseok. Intoxicated with bliss each time his name appeared on her screen, making her wan moonlight skin turn a scarlet red, regardless of what his message said.

So far, it had only been two days since they had begun texting.

In her eyes, it felt as though their conversation persisted endlessly. They picked up on former messages whenever they had the opportunity to do so, he worked in the morning, which caused her to wait a few hours before she can get another response. Then, she would have to put their conversation on hold once more when her grueling night shift started.

She woke an hour earlier than normal in order to capture a few messages with him before he left to work. Seren didn't expect him to be a software architect, it almost blew her mind when he told her about it. He also mentioned how he also considered being a geologist back when he was in school, it was something she would have never guessed.

It simply amazed her how complex his occupation seemed, safely assuming that Hoseok was very intelligent.
